Agilus is seeking a dedicated Registered Nurse to join their team, working 2 to 3 shifts weekly with the flexibility to take on additional hours. You will assist with WSIB claims, manage occupational illnesses, and ensure thorough documentation of medical activities. Your nursing expertise is essential for supporting workplace health and safety initiatives.
Key Responsibilities:
• Assist with WSIB claims and return-to-work programs
• Treat and follow up on occupational injuries
• Coordinate reporting processes of workplace incidents
• Document medical surveillance and assessments
• Provide health counseling and education to employees
Requirements:
• Registered Nurse in good standing with the College of Nurses
• Over five years in occupational nursing or related fields
• Knowledge of Ontario Health & Safety legislation
• Strong decision-making and interpersonal skills
• Availability for flexible shifts, including weekends
